      Over the years, we have acquired a great number of variations of our domains, or industry-specific domains to protect our brand. Currently, the majority of those domains are parked at the registrars. Would we do any harm to our rankings if we pointed the dormant domains to our website (www.ellsworth.com)? If not, are there any recommendations as the best way to do this, or just point them to the same IP?

                  Do theses domains have links pointing to them?  If not, 301ing them to your domain won't have any SEO benefit.  There could be a traffic benefit if any of these urls get type in traffic.

                  If the domains had backlinks then yes, doing a 301 redirect will pass the majority of the link equity on to the main domain.
